Gavin Taylor
Professor, Computer Science Department

Gavin's research interests cover numerous topics in Machine Learning and Data Science.  One area of interest is in Reinforcement Learning, or learned autonomy. Example ongoing projects include enabling chemical factories to learn to make a better product while running more efficiently (with McMaster University), and teaching weather stations to make the most informative measurements while conserving energy given weather forecasts, and the measurements of nearby stations (with NTNU in Norway).

Gavin is also particularly interested in Machine Learning performed on huge amounts of data on high performance computing systems, and helps direct the USNA's Center for High Performance Computing.  His research in this area includes understanding and improving the optimization of Machine Learning models on large distributed systems (with the University of Maryland-College Park).
